Our Partners

Native Android Developer [Job ID: 96217321]

hameed Taj, Karachi, Pakistan - Office Based

Address: Balad Trade Center II, Bahadurabad, Karachi

Job Type

Full-Time

Experience

2-3 Years

Degree

Bachelor's

Positions

1

Salary

Market Competitive

Gender

Male

Category

Software Development (Mobile and Web Development)

Degree Names

Bachelor's in bs computer / software
Bachelor's in Computer Science
Bachelor's in Software Engineering

Description

At SANDS Tech, we are committed to building exceptional mobile applications that enhance user experiences. We are looking for a talented and dedicated Native Android Developer to join our team and create high-performance Android applications. If you are passionate about Android development and thrive on innovation, we’d love to hear from you.

Responsibilities

  • Design, develop, and maintain native Android applications using Kotlin and Java.
  • Collaborate with cross-functional teams, including designers, product managers, and backend developers, to deliver high-quality solutions.
  • Write clean, maintainable, and scalable code adhering to Android development standards.
  • Ensure app quality, performance, and responsiveness through comprehensive testing and debugging.
  • Integrate RESTful APIs and third-party libraries into Android applications.
  • Optimize applications for maximum performance and scalability across a variety of devices.
  • Stay updated with the latest Android development trends, tools, and frameworks.
  • Troubleshoot and resolve application bugs and crashes effectively.

Requirements

  • Bachelor’s degree in Computer Science, Software Engineering, or a related field.
  • 2–4 years of experience in Android app development.
  • Proficiency in Kotlin and Java programming languages.
  • Solid understanding of Android SDK, Jetpack components, and architecture patterns like MVVM or MVP.
  • Experience with tools like Android Studio, Gradle, and Git.
  • Familiarity with Google Play Store guidelines and app submission processes.
  • Knowledge of UI/UX principles and the ability to implement custom user interfaces.
  • Experience with tools for testing and debugging, such as Espresso and Firebase.
  • Strong problem-solving skills and a keen attention to detail.


Benefits

  • Competitive salary package and performance-based incentives.
  • Comprehensive benefits, including medical coverage and life insurance.
  • Opportunities for career growth and skill development through challenging projects.
  • A collaborative and innovative work environment that values creativity.
  • Annual increments and paid time off.


Required Skills